JPL ANALYSIS REPORT   GPS-WEEK 0972 (DAYS 235-241, DATES 1998 Aug 23 - Aug 29)
******************************************************************************

Submitted by the JPL IGS/FLINN Analysis Team:

D C Jefferson, Y E Bar-Sever, M B Heflin, M M Watkins, F H Webb, J F Zumberge

all at the Jet Propulsion Laboratory, California Institute of Technology, 
Pasadena, CA  91109.

Files listed below are available in Unix compressed format and can be
retrieved using anonymous ftp to sideshow.jpl.nasa.gov (137.78.60.30),
directory pub/jpligsac/0972.  These files (except for *.tro) have also
been sent to the CDDIS.

Median Orbit Repeatability (see table below): 11.0 cm

Due to potential problems, data from stations mentioned below were not
considered for use in the global solution for the day indicated.  (For
geographical reasons, they may not have been used in any case.)

WARNING: GOL2 (not USNO) used as reference clock day 235-237.
WARNING: NRC1 (not USNO) used as reference clock days 238.
WARNING: Data from COCO, HOB2 excluded day 235.
WARNING: Data from COCO, HOB2, IISC, LPGS, NYA1 excluded day 236.
WARNING: Data from BAHR, COCO, DAV1, HOB2, HOLC, HRAO, IISC, LPGS, MALI, NYAL, PENC, TROM, YAR1 excluded day 237.
WARNING: Data from ANKR, BAHR, COCO, DAV1, HOB2, HRAO, IISC, LPGS, MALI, PENC, STJO, YAR1 excluded day 238.
WARNING: Data from COCO, DAV1, HARK, HOB2, HRAO, IISC, KELY, MALI, PENC, YAR1 excluded day 239.
WARNING: Data from COCO, HARK, HERS, HOB2, LPGS, MCM4, NYAL excluded day 240.
WARNING: Data from COCO, HARK, LPGS, MCM4, YELL excluded day 241.
